How Many Cfm Do I Need For A Bathroom Exhaust Fan . For example, if your bathroom is 80 square feet, you will need to choose an exhaust fan with a cfm rating of 80. A fan with the correct cfm should draw in enough air to refresh all the air in your bathroom at least eight times per hour. Bathroom fan cfm charts can be categorized into low, medium and high based on the required air change rate per hour and a fixed bathroom ceiling height. Select a fan with one cfm for every square foot of floor area. A general rule is 1 cfm per square foot plus. Bathroom exhaust fans can produce anywhere from 40 cfm to 350 cfm of airflow.
